What is the Course Change Form?
The Course Change Form serves as an essential tool for students at Blue Ridge Community and Technical College, facilitating necessary adjustments to their course enrollments. This form allows students to request various changes, such as modifications to course sections, overload requests, or adjustments to audit or pass/fail status. It is crucial for students to gather the necessary signatures from instructors and an advisor to validate their requests, ensuring proper enrollment processes are followed.

Signing and Notarizing the Course Change Form
Signature requirements for the Course Change Form ensure that all necessary approvals are obtained. Each form must feature signatures from the student, their instructors, and an advisor to validate the changes. Students should choose between utilizing digital signatures for more efficient processing or wet signatures, depending on their preference. It's important to note that notarization is typically not required for this form.

Who is eligible to use the Course Change Form?
Any student enrolled at Blue Ridge Community and Technical College who wants to modify their course enrollment is eligible to fill out the Course Change Form.
What are the deadlines for submitting the Course Change Form?
Deadlines for submitting the Course Change Form can vary. It is recommended to check the academic calendar or consult with your advisor for specific dates related to course changes.
How do I submit the Course Change Form after completing it?
After completing the Course Change Form, you can submit it to the Enrollment Management office. Ensure you have obtained all necessary signatures before submission.
Are there any supporting documents required with the Course Change Form?
Usually, no additional supporting documents are required with the Course Change Form beyond the required signatures from your instructor and advisor. However, it's best to check with your institution.
What common mistakes should I avoid when filling out the Course Change Form?
Common mistakes include forgetting to obtain required signatures, failing to fill out all necessary fields, and not reviewing the form for accuracy before submission.
How long does it take to process the Course Change Form?
Processing times for the Course Change Form can vary. Generally, it may take a few days for the Enrollment Management office to process your request.
Can I make multiple requests on one Course Change Form?
No, each Course Change Form should address a single request. For additional changes, please complete separate forms as necessary.
